
In Exodus 3, God speaks to an outcast who is working as a lowly shepherd. God calls this outcast, named Moses, to deliver God’s people out of bondage in Egypt and lead them to freedom. This is an enormous task that God places before him. How does Moses respond?
He says, “Mi Anoki“.
In 1 Samuel 18, the King of God’s people, King Saul, offers his eldest daughter to marry a young shepherd boy. This young shepherd boy, named David, is going to be called by God to become the greatest king that the world has ever seen. If that task isn’t colossal enough, God also promises that the Savior of the human race, Jesus Christ, will be born through his lineage. How does David respond?
He says, “Mi Anoki.”
In Matthew 8:18-20, Mark 16:14-18, Luke 24:47, John 4:34-38, and Acts 1:8, God has called Christians to a great task. God has called Christians to share the Gospel, the good news, throughout all the Earth! He used these four verses to call me to take the gospel and share it across 11 countries. What is my response?
I say, “Mi Anoki.”
Mi Anoki is Hebrew for “Who am I.” By definition, it is the acceptance of a great honor or privilege while acknowledging one’s unworthiness. God has called me to share His love across 11 countries for 11 months. I ask Him, “Who am I?” because this is a task that is bigger than I am and more than I deserve. Moses and David were presented with an impossible task, yet God called them to do it. He equipped them and carried them through. I am not, by any means, comparing myself to either Moses or David. Their lives and ministries were legendary! What I am sharing, is that the same God that called them and carried them through, is calling me to the Worldrace.
